Aspiring medical students across India gear up for the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ET) 2024, a crucial examination that determines their admission to medical and dental colleges. Amidst the preparation frenzy, it’s essential to strategize not only for mastering the subjects but also for navigating the exam day smoothly. In this blog, we’ll discuss five common mistakes to avoid on NEET 2024 exam day, ensuring that your hard work pays off.
Skipping Breakfast:
Many students underestimate the importance of a nutritious breakfast on exam day. Skipping breakfast can lead to fatigue, lack of concentration, and decreased performance during the exam. Ensure you have a balanced meal rich in proteins, carbohydrates, and vitamins to fuel your brain and body for the rigorous exam ahead.
Arriving Late:
Arriving late to the exam center can be a stressful start to your NEET journey. Plan your travel route in advance, considering traffic conditions and possible delays. Aim to reach the exam center well before the reporting time to avoid last-minute panic. Remember, punctuality sets the tone for a calm and focused mindset during the exam.

Neglecting Essential Documents:
Forgetting to carry essential documents like the admit card and valid ID proof is a grave mistake that can jeopardize your NEET aspirations. Double-check your exam bag the night before to ensure you have all necessary documents in place. Keep your admit card and ID proof safely organized to avoid any last-minute hassles.
Overlooking Exam Instructions:
Amidst the exam pressure, students often overlook crucial exam instructions provided by the invigilators. Take a few minutes to carefully read and understand the exam guidelines before starting the paper. Pay attention to details like marking scheme, question paper format, and time allocation for each section to optimize your performance.
Panic During the Exam:
Feeling overwhelmed or panicking during the exam can impair your ability to think clearly and solve questions accurately. If you encounter a challenging question, take a deep breath, and remain composed. Start with easier questions to build confidence and then tackle the tougher ones. Remember, maintaining a positive attitude and staying focused can help you overcome obstacles and perform your best.
